Re: SYSTEM SPECS
How much free RAM do you have after rebooting your PC, but without any apps running in background? On average maps, Panzer Corps 2 currently uses like 1-1.5GB of RAM, but on some bigger maps I've seen it spiking to 2-3GB. This is reason why I currently put 8GB as a requirement. We'll see if we can relax this requirement before the release. There is still a lot of optimization potential.

Re: SYSTEM SPECS
There is some work still to be done to remove remaining hard limits from the game (e. g. break some textures used for the map into segments to avoid the limit of max texture size), but once this is done, map size will be limited only by available system resources.
Why would we create a new game for 10 year old systems? The game is fully compatible with UHD. In fact, it looks gorgeous on such screens, because all assets, including unit models, terrain and UI, are designed in 4k. I'm playing the game on 4k myself.
However, we have not tested it in 3d and don't consider it high priority. Perhaps later, when more important tasks are finished. I think, Unreal Engine has support for this, so it should not be too difficult to try and see how it works.

Re: SYSTEM SPECS
I have no idea how much RAM such a map would require. Is it possible to download this map anywhere? In fact, I have not seen any maps even remotely close to this size. All kinds of problems are possible, from AI issues (in case this map relies on AI), to generating strategic map and minimap and who knows what else. At this point, I cannot guarantee it will run on your system.
Right now, a convertor exists but does not cover systems which are not fully finished in Panzer Corps 2 yet (most notably scripting). This will be fixed as we go forwards with the project. However, we are seeing from experience of converting some other maps that game balance can be seriously off because of changed game rules and unit stats. Without manual correction of balance, some converted maps can become pretty much unplayable.
